Monster Hunter Wilds, the next installment in Capcom’s Monster Hunter series, won’t be arriving until next year. However, GameSpot was invited to a hands on preview during Gamescom, and senior producer Jean-Luc Seipke is sharing their Monster Hunter Wilds experience in our video overview. And there’s a lot for fans to look forward to.The first thing that fans may notice is that Monster Hunter Wilds has a much bigger map to explore than previous titles. The Monster Hunter camp site is also directly connected to the map this time, and a further sense of community can be found while going on four player co-op hunts. Players are also allowed to pick secondary weapons, which dramatically changes combat in the game.

Black Myth: Wukong has already delivered one of the biggest launches in Steam history, making it one of the most successful games of 2024 just a day after release. Amid some performance complaints from PC players, developer Game Science posted an update that noted that you may experience “occasional serious issues” playing it on PC, due to the “game’s vast scale and the myriad of software and hardware environments.”Many resource-intensive games suffer from some degree of technical issues after launch, but Game Science has taken the unusual step of providing a detailed FAQ that breaks down common problems that players have reported. These include video memory errors with 13th and 14th generation Intel CPUs, a driver issue with AMD GPUs, and frame rate woes, especially with 40-series Nvidia …
Read moreCivilization VII received a surprisingly close release date with a new trailer at Gamescom Opening Night Live. The new trailer debuted some of the new features and major revisions coming to this version of the long-running 4X strategy series, as well as announced the release date: February 11, 2025. Two special editions will grant early access on February 6. Unlike the last Civ, the PC and console versions will release simultaneously.Civilization VII features a new Ages system that splits the flow into three distinct eras, with their own playable civilizations, resources, and gameplay systems. Unlocking milestones within each Age will let you carry advantages into the next era. Read moreThe new Dune Awakening trailer, debuted at Gamescom Opening Night Live, showed off its survival gameplay and announced a release window of early 2025. The trailer offers a peak into the general arc of the game. You’ll start Dune: Awakening by creating your character and choosing their background, before crashing into the middle of the planet. Staying out in the desert is perilous. You can get sun stroke and heat exhaustion from standing in the sun, and sandworms will detect you if you run on open ground. The trailer then showcases taking out an NPC encampment. The game offers multiple strategies and approaches: You can get in close with a blade, attack with guns, block ranged fire with a shield, and even deploy a hunter seeker drone to kill from afar.
